Not
Bu sayfaya erişim yetkilendirme gerektiriyor. Oturum açmayı veya dizinleri değiştirmeyi deneyebilirsiniz.
Bu sayfaya erişim yetkilendirme gerektiriyor. Dizinleri değiştirmeyi deneyebilirsiniz.
'type' : Yok edicisi olan bir başvuru türü, statik veri üyesi 'member' türü olarak kullanılamaz
Açıklamalar
Ortak dil çalışma zamanı, sınıf statik üye işlevi de içerdiğinde kullanıcı tanımlı bir yıkıcının ne zaman çalıştırıldığından emin olamaz.
Nesne açıkça silinmediği sürece bir yıkıcı hiçbir zaman çalıştırılamaz.
Daha fazla bilgi için bkz. ,
Örnek
Aşağıdaki örnek C3162 oluşturur.
// C3162.cpp
// compile with: /clr /c
ref struct A {
~A() { System::Console::WriteLine("in destructor"); }
static A i; // C3162
static A^ a = gcnew A; // OK
};
int main() {
A ^ a = gcnew A;
delete a;
}